Changeset View
Changeset View
Standalone View
Standalone View
files/0002-tests-souphttpsrc-Make-ssl_cert-key_file-static.patch
- This file was added.
| From e0ac30bc06da0ffd78334621c9ee42fa8f92f195 Mon Sep 17 00:00:00 2001 | |||||
| From: "Jan Alexander Steffens (heftig)" <jan.steffens@gmail.com> | |||||
| Date: Tue, 20 Jun 2017 16:34:41 +0200 | |||||
| Subject: [PATCH 2/4] tests: souphttpsrc: Make ssl_cert/key_file static | |||||
| Just a bit of cleanup. | |||||
| https://bugzilla.gnome.org/show_bug.cgi?id=784005 | |||||
| --- | |||||
| tests/check/elements/souphttpsrc.c | 7 ++++--- | |||||
| 1 file changed, 4 insertions(+), 3 deletions(-) | |||||
| diff --git a/tests/check/elements/souphttpsrc.c b/tests/check/elements/souphttpsrc.c | |||||
| index a6231fab85eeb9e2..6dedae50a64a3dc0 100644 | |||||
| --- a/tests/check/elements/souphttpsrc.c | |||||
| +++ b/tests/check/elements/souphttpsrc.c | |||||
| @@ -52,6 +52,9 @@ static const char *realm = "SOUPHTTPSRC_REALM"; | |||||
| static const char *basic_auth_path = "/basic_auth"; | |||||
| static const char *digest_auth_path = "/digest_auth"; | |||||
| +static const char *ssl_cert_file = GST_TEST_FILES_PATH "/test-cert.pem"; | |||||
| +static const char *ssl_key_file = GST_TEST_FILES_PATH "/test-key.pem"; | |||||
| + | |||||
| static guint get_port_from_server (SoupServer * server); | |||||
| static SoupServer *run_server (gboolean use_https); | |||||
| @@ -123,7 +126,7 @@ run_test (gboolean use_https, const gchar * path, gint expected) | |||||
| g_free (url); | |||||
| g_object_set (src, "automatic-redirect", redirect, NULL); | |||||
| - g_object_set (src, "ssl-ca-file", GST_TEST_FILES_PATH "/test-cert.pem", NULL); | |||||
| + g_object_set (src, "ssl-ca-file", ssl_cert_file, NULL); | |||||
| if (cookies != NULL) | |||||
| g_object_set (src, "cookies", cookies, NULL); | |||||
| g_object_set (sink, "signal-handoffs", TRUE, NULL); | |||||
| @@ -572,8 +575,6 @@ run_server (gboolean use_https) | |||||
| if (use_https) { | |||||
| - const char *ssl_cert_file = GST_TEST_FILES_PATH "/test-cert.pem"; | |||||
| - const char *ssl_key_file = GST_TEST_FILES_PATH "/test-key.pem"; | |||||
| GTlsBackend *backend = g_tls_backend_get_default (); | |||||
| if (backend == NULL || !g_tls_backend_supports_tls (backend)) { | |||||
| -- | |||||
| 2.13.1 | |||||
Copyright © 2015-2021 Solus Project. The Solus logo is Copyright © 2016-2021 Solus Project. All Rights Reserved.